Signature Meaning
Ganesha is the name of a widely revered Hindu deity, recognizable by his elephant head and association with wisdom. The name is traditionally understood from Sanskrit roots to mean "lord of the ganas" or "leader of the multitudes." It is commonly used across South Asian cultures and often chosen to invoke blessings for removing obstacles and for success in new beginnings.
